The Business

Since the original tommee tippee spill-proof child cup was first launched over 50 years ago, the brand has become renowned for its intuitive products which help children make the transition from first latch to independent feeding.

tommee tippee is now the number-one brand of baby feeding accessories in the UK and remains one of the most trusted and recognisable baby brands in the world, loved by babies and recommended by generations of parents.

The Role

The Senior Global Product Manager is responsible for the commercial and creative development of global NPD initiatives, in order to deliver incremental Sales and Profit performance.

Once a project scope has been defined by the Global Category team, you will be fully accountable for development of the business case – including product specification, design and packaging, as well as financial evaluation and associated cap-ex sign-off.

You will then work in collaboration with other leaders in the business, to ensure that relevant new product - which will grow category and regional profitability, enhance the tommee tippee brand, and delight consumers - is available on-shelf, on time, via chosen distribution outlets.
